Securing Your BMS: Best Practices for Digital Safety
Protecting your building 's Management System (BMS) is vitally important in today's connected landscape. Adopting robust protection protocols is not simply optional. Start by frequently updating firmware and programs to eliminate known vulnerabilities. Control access by implementing strong passwords and two-factor security. Furthermore , separate your network to hinder unauthorized access and establish defined response plans to handle any breaches . Finally, perform regular security scans to identify and remediate any gaps before they can be exploited by cybercriminals and bad actors.

Beyond Passwords: Advanced BMS Cybersecurity Strategies
The reliance on standard passwords for Building Management System (BMS) security is becoming inadequate in today's complex threat landscape. Current BMS cybersecurity methods must move here far beyond this basic layer. A reliable defense demands a multifaceted approach, encompassing various critical elements. These include implementing multi-factor approval, periodically conducting vulnerability assessments, and proactively monitoring network traffic. Furthermore, partitioning the BMS infrastructure from corporate IT systems is essential to prevent broad movement after a breach. Finally, continuous staff training on data safety best procedures is critical to mitigate the danger of human error.
- Utilize Multi-Factor Approval
- Perform Regular Security Assessments
- Track Network Data
- Partition the BMS Network
- Provide Ongoing Employee Instruction
